I know you’re probably thinking, “Why is he talking about summer when I’ve just started breaking out my sweaters!?!” But November, December and January are all great months to consider having body sculpting procedures such as SmartLipo or VASER done. Here’s why:
On average, it takes 4 – 6 months for the final results to appear after undergoing SmartLipo or VASER. You will definitely see some results immediately, but over the next 6 months you will also see continued improvement as your body sheds excess fluid and the swelling subsides. If you schedule your SmartLipo or VASER procedure now, your new silhouette will be ready for unveiling as soon as the temperature starts to rise.
After a SmartLipo or VASER procedure, you’ll need to wear a compression garment as you heal and your body takes on its new shape. Cooler weather means longer sleeves and pants – which make it easier to camouflage the compression garment. Plus, the compression garment acts as an insulator, keeping you warm when temperatures drop.
Most people take time off during the holidays. So if you complete your procedure during your regularly scheduled winter vacation, you’ll have more time to relax and recuperate before you return to work.

The winter months are also a great time to schedule SmartXide DOT Laser skin resurfacing. After being treated with the SmartXide DOT Laser, we advise you to stay out of the sun as much as possible while your skin regenerates and the new skin grows in. It’s much easier to avoid the sun during the winter than it is during Houston’s scorching summers. (Although I still recommend that you wear sunscreen every day of the year – no matter what the thermometer reads.)
